Chain of Craters road: descent from Kīlauea Visitor Center to the sea, then ascent via the same route
Made with Bob's gravel: 100% asphalt


Preamble : After visiting Mauna Kea (4205m) and Mauna Loa (4169m), make way for their youngest brother (which adjoins Mauna Loa), one of the most active volcanoes on the planet, almost perpetually erupting 🌋 (strictly speaking, we should probably speak of "emerged" youngest brother because of the existence of the family's submarine cadet, the Kamaʻehuakanaloa , ex-Lōʻihi... but I don't know their exact dates of birth ). 🎂

🏁 Departure from the Kīlauea Visitor Center (in the Hawaii Volcanoes National Park ) with Clarence and Luke, via the Crater Rim road, which circled the summit caldera completely before the 2018 eruption (the summit of Kīlauea corresponds at the highest rim of this caldera, at 1246m), which led, among other things, to the emptying of the lava lake (since reformed) of the Halema'uma'u crater, whose rims collapsed (I will go and observe it from night a few days later: a breathtaking sight!). 🔥🥰🔥 We then branch off on the Chain of Craters road. Here again, it is a road regularly at the mercy of the moods of the volcano, the route of which has evolved over time. Lava flows from the Pu'u 'Ō'ō crater (which is also part of Kīlauea and hosted another lava lake between 1983 and 2018) have notably buried some old sections of road under thicknesses of lava sometimes reaching 35m! 😮

After a passage in the forest (quite dense), we cross several lava flows, more or less recent, and we pass on the edge of several craters (well yes... hence the name of the road!). There are even a few " nēnē " barnacle geese 🦆 (endemic species of Hawaii).

From the panorama that dominates the Pacific by several hundred meters, we can clearly distinguish the flows that have enlarged the island with each new eruption. The road then plunges towards the ocean: there is no more forest, and it blows... really hard! 💨 Uncomfortable with the curved gravel handlebars, I have to stop in the final part of the descent to relax my fingers. 😵 I still end up finding Luke and Clarence, and we go along the sea to the final barrier, shortly after the Hōlei marine arch . It is at this level that the asphalted part ends: the road that previously continued to the village of Kalapana fell victim to the lava flows. A track has since been rebuilt, however, and it is possible to continue in gravel (until a next eruption?), but Luke and Clarence are on road bikes: so we turn back.
